/**
* Tests for Utility Functions
* Tests helper functions that can be extracted and tested
*/
describe('Utility Functions', () => {
describe('parseCommand', () => {
// This function parses command strings into command and args
function parseCommand(cmdString) {
const parts = [];
let current = '';
let inQuotes = false;
let quoteChar = '';
for (let i = 0; i < cmdString.length; i++) {
const char = cmdString[i];
if ((char === '"' || char === "'") && !inQuotes) {
inQuotes = true;
quoteChar = char;
} else if (char === quoteChar && inQuotes) {
inQuotes = false;
quoteChar = '';
} else if (char === ' ' && !inQuotes) {
if (current) {
parts.push(current);
current = '';
}
} else {
current += char;
}
}
if (current) {
parts.push(current);
}
return {
command: parts[0],
args: parts.slice(1),
};
}
test('should parse simple command', () => {
const result = parseCommand('pandoc input.md -o output.pdf');
expect(result.command).toBe('pandoc');
expect(result.args).toEqual(['input.md', '-o', 'output.pdf']);
});
test('should handle double-quoted paths', () => {
const result = parseCommand('pandoc "C:/path with spaces/file.md" -o output.pdf');
expect(result.command).toBe('pandoc');
expect(result.args).toEqual(['C:/path with spaces/file.md', '-o', 'output.pdf']);
});
test('should handle single-quoted paths', () => {
const result = parseCommand("pandoc 'file name.md' -o output.pdf");
expect(result.command).toBe('pandoc');
expect(result.args).toEqual(['file name.md', '-o', 'output.pdf']);
});
test('should handle multiple options', () => {
const result = parseCommand(
'pandoc input.md --pdf-engine=xelatex -V geometry:margin=1in -o output.pdf'
);
expect(result.command).toBe('pandoc');
expect(result.args).toContain('--pdf-engine=xelatex');
expect(result.args).toContain('-V');
});
test('should handle empty command', () => {
const result = parseCommand('');
expect(result.command).toBeUndefined();
expect(result.args).toEqual([]);
});
});
describe('hexToRgb', () => {
// This function converts hex colors to RGB
function hexToRgb(hex) {
const result = /^#?([a-f\d]{2})([a-f\d]{2})([a-f\d]{2})$/i.exec(hex);
return result
? {
r: parseInt(result[1], 16) / 255,
g: parseInt(result[2], 16) / 255,
b: parseInt(result[3], 16) / 255,
}
: null;
}
test('should convert black hex to RGB', () => {
const result = hexToRgb('#000000');
expect(result).toEqual({ r: 0, g: 0, b: 0 });
});
test('should convert white hex to RGB', () => {
const result = hexToRgb('#ffffff');
expect(result).toEqual({ r: 1, g: 1, b: 1 });
});
test('should convert red hex to RGB', () => {
const result = hexToRgb('#ff0000');
expect(result.r).toBeCloseTo(1);
expect(result.g).toBeCloseTo(0);
expect(result.b).toBeCloseTo(0);
});
test('should handle hex without hash', () => {
const result = hexToRgb('00ff00');
expect(result.r).toBeCloseTo(0);
expect(result.g).toBeCloseTo(1);
expect(result.b).toBeCloseTo(0);
});
test('should return null for invalid hex', () => {
expect(hexToRgb('invalid')).toBeNull();
expect(hexToRgb('#xyz')).toBeNull();
});
});
